The Impact of Modern Preferences on Restaurant Choices: Lifestyle, Culinary Expectations and Regional Dynamics

In an era shaped by rapid globalization and evolving consumer preferences, the restaurant industry faces dynamic challenges influenced by lifestyle changes, culinary expectations, and regional dynamics. This study explores the multifaceted impact of modern preferences on restaurant choices across diverse demographics. Firstly, lifestyle shifts towards convenience and health consciousness have transformed dining habits. Consumers increasingly favor restaurants offering quick, nutritious options that align with their busy schedules and dietary preferences. This trend underscores the rising demand for transparency in sourcing and preparation methods. Secondly, culinary expectations play a pivotal role in shaping restaurant selections. Preferences for authenticity, innovation, and experiential dining have heightened competition among establishments. Diners seek unique gastronomic experiences that blend traditional flavors with contemporary twists, stimulating creativity in menu offerings and ambiance. Thirdly, regional dynamics significantly influence restaurant preferences. Cultural diversity dictates varying tastes and dining rituals, necessitating localized adaptations by restaurateurs. Understanding regional nuances enables establishments to tailor menus and services to cater effectively to local palates and traditions. This study employs a mixed-methods approach, combining quantitative surveys and qualitative interviews across urban and rural settings. Statistical analysis highlights correlations between demographic factors, lifestyle choices, and restaurant preferences. Qualitative insights delve into consumer perceptions, exploring the emotional and experiential dimensions driving dining decisions.
